Why Roofing Codes Matter In Louisiana
The climate of Louisiana, which includes high humidity, persistent rain, and hurricanes, makes roofing requirements essential. These requirements demand long-lasting methods, such as additional barriers to stop leaks and better, more compliant, fastening procedures.
By adhering to these guidelines, you can safeguard your safety and investment, lessen the chance that your roof will fail during a storm, and potentially receive greater coverage for storm damage and decrease insurance costs.
Key Authorities and Regulatory Bodies
- Louisiana State Uniform Construction Code Council (LSUCCC): Adopts state building regulations, including roofing standards.
- Department of Public Safety: Enforces the state construction code.
- Office of the State Fire Marshal: Ensures fire safety and roofing code compliance.
- International Code Council (ICC): Provides model codes like the International Building Code, which Louisiana adapts.

3. Roof Drainage Specifications
Due to Louisiana’s heavy rainfall and flooding risks, effective drainage is crucial:
- Slope Requirements: Roofs should have a slope of at least 1/4 inch per foot to help with drainage, unless designed for snow and ice.
- Drainage Systems: Roofs need primary drains at low points and secondary overflow drains or scuppers to handle excess water if the main drains fail. Overflow drains should direct water away from the building.
4. Flashings and Roof Penetrations
Proper installation of flashings and handling of roof penetrations are crucial to avoid leaks:
- Flashing Installation: Flashing must be installed around all roof penetrations and transitions to walls or other roof sections, including areas around chimneys, vents, and skylights.
- Sealing: All roof penetrations must be thoroughly sealed to prevent water intrusion, which can cause significant structural damage over time.
5. Material Requirements
Louisiana’s building code for roofs detail the materials acceptable for roofing systems, including:
- Asphalt Shingles: Popular for their cost-effectiveness and ease of installation, these must meet durability standards like ASTM D-225 or D-3462.
- Metal Roofing: Valued for its durability and ability to withstand harsh weather, but it must comply with specific wind resistance ratings.
- Tile and Slate: Chosen for their durability and visual appeal, these materials require proper installation to prevent leaks.
Roofing materials must have labels from approved testing agencies to show they meet standards.
6. Attic Access and Ventilation
The codes also cover attic access and ventilation:
- Access Requirements: Attics need an access opening of at least 20 inches by 30 inches, with a clear height of at least 30 inches for easy maintenance.
- Ventilation: Proper ventilation is needed to avoid moisture buildup that can cause mold and damage. Ventilation must follow the guidelines.

Specific Roofing Requirements
1. Roofing Material Fire Protection (Section R902)
Roofing materials are categorized into three classes based on their fire resistance: Class A, B, and C. These classifications are important in areas prone to fires or where buildings are close together:
This section categorizes roofing materials by their fire resistance:
- Class A: Highest level of fire resistance, including materials like brick, metal, and clay tiles. Often required where roofs are close together.
- Class B: Moderate fire resistance, suitable for many residential uses.
- Class C: Lowest fire resistance, used in areas with lower fire risk.
Testing Standards: Materials must be tested to meet fire resistance standards like UL 790 or ASTM E108.
2. Weather Protection
Louisiana’s roofing regulations are designed to handle the state’s challenging weather conditions. Coastal areas, vulnerable to hurricanes, have strict requirements for roofing materials and construction methods in order to meet ASTM standards for wind resistance.
Key Weather-Related Requirements:
- Waterproofing: Roofs must be properly sealed to prevent leaks.
- Drainage: Gutters and downspouts must be installed correctly to manage rainwater.
- Mold Prevention: Guidelines for ventilation and material choices help reduce the risk of mold growth.
Section R903: Weather Protection covers:
- Roof Coverings: Must be securely attached and installed as instructed.
- Flashing: Installed at joints and roof penetrations to prevent water entry.
- Crickets and Saddles: Used around larger roof penetrations to direct water away and minimize leaks.
3. Hurricane Mitigation
Another essential part of Louisiana’s roofing codes is hurricane mitigation. To secure the roofing structure, hurricane straps and clips must be used. Requirements for attaching the roof deck are also included to guarantee that roofs survive strong storms. By taking these precautions, dwellings are better shielded from the destructive power of hurricanes.
8. Special Rules for Flood Zones
For buildings in flood areas, there are a few extra rules:
- Elevation Requirements: Buildings must be raised above the base flood elevation to prevent water damage during floods.
- Material Selection: Roofing materials in flood-prone areas need to resist water damage and decay for better durability and safety.
Additional Considerations for Louisiana Roofs
When planning a roofing project in Louisiana, consider these additional factors:
- Fortified Roofing Program: This optional program encourages homeowners to install roofs that go beyond basic code requirements. Fortified roofs are better at handling hurricane winds and may qualify for insurance discounts.
- Local Amendments: Some towns or local governments might have extra rules on top of the basic building codes. Check with your local building department to make sure you follow any additional local requirements.
